    Failure Modeling of Small and Medium-Sized Water Distribution Networks Based on a Hybrid Ranking Model

    Source: Journal of Water Resources Planning and Management:;2026:;Volume ( 152 ):;issue: 003::page 04025076-1

    Abstract: AbstractTo ensure water supply safety and reduce environmental impact, it is essential to conduct failure modeling on water distribution networks (WDNs) to prevent pipe failures. However, the limited and imbalanced pipe break data in small and medium-...Practical ApplicationsDeep learning algorithms have emerged as powerful tools for predicting failures in water mains, but their effectiveness hinges on access to large volumes of failed pipe data from water distribution networks. However, small and medium-...
